What Types of Wooden Doors Can You Import from China?
Chinese manufacturers produce a wide range of wooden doors for residential, hospitality, commercial, and industrial projects. Buyers can source standard designs or request customized solutions for specific architectural requirements. Manufacturers also offer flexible materials, finishes, and hardware integration to meet international market preferences.
Solid Wood Doors
Solid wood doors remain one of the most popular categories in the international construction market. Manufacturers use hardwood materials such as oak, walnut, teak, ash, and mahogany to create durable and premium products. These doors provide strong structural performance, natural appearance, and long-term value for luxury residential and hotel projects.
Many buyers prefer solid wood doors because they offer better sound insulation and enhanced durability compared to lightweight alternatives. Chinese suppliers now use advanced drying technology and CNC machinery to improve consistency and reduce moisture-related defects during export shipping. This process improves product stability in different climate conditions.
Engineered Wood Doors
Engineered wood doors combine wood veneers with composite core materials to reduce manufacturing costs while maintaining a premium appearance. These doors deliver better dimensional stability and lower weight, making them suitable for apartments, offices, and commercial buildings. Many importers choose engineered options for large-scale construction projects due to cost efficiency.
Manufacturers often use MDF, plywood, or honeycomb structures inside engineered wooden doors. This design helps reduce warping and cracking during transportation and installation. Buyers searching for Bulk wooden door solutions frequently select engineered products because they balance affordability, durability, and modern design flexibility.
Interior and Exterior Wooden Doors
Interior wooden doors focus on appearance, lightweight construction, and space optimization. Manufacturers typically use veneer finishes, laminated surfaces, and decorative panels for bedrooms, offices, and living spaces. Interior products often prioritize design consistency and easy installation rather than extreme weather resistance.
Exterior wooden doors require stronger materials and protective coatings because they face moisture, sunlight, temperature changes, and heavy daily use. Chinese suppliers apply waterproof finishes, reinforced frames, and durable hardware systems to improve performance. Buyers importing exterior products must confirm weather resistance specifications before shipment approval.

How Can You Find Reliable Wooden Door Manufacturers in China?
Finding reliable suppliers remains one of the most important steps in the importing process. Buyers must evaluate manufacturers carefully to avoid product quality problems, delayed shipments, or communication failures. A structured supplier verification process helps businesses build stable sourcing partnerships.
Use Trusted B2B Sourcing Channels
Professional buyers often search for suppliers through B2B marketplaces, trade fairs, sourcing agents, and manufacturer websites. Platforms such as Alibaba and Made-in-China allow buyers to compare product catalogs, certifications, and customer reviews. However, importers should still conduct independent verification before placing large orders.
Trade fairs such as the Canton Fair and CIFF provide direct access to manufacturers and product samples. Face-to-face meetings allow buyers to inspect production quality and discuss technical requirements more effectively. Many experienced importers build stronger supplier relationships through factory visits and in-person negotiations.
Verify Business Credentials
Reliable suppliers should provide valid business licenses, export certificates, and factory information. Buyers should confirm whether the company operates as a direct manufacturer or a trading company. Factory verification helps importers understand production capacity, quality management systems, and customization capabilities before order confirmation.
Third-party inspection agencies can perform factory audits and production assessments. These audits often review machinery, workforce size, material sourcing, and quality control systems. Professional verification reduces sourcing risks and improves confidence when importing large quantities of Wholesale Wooden Door products.
Evaluate Communication and Responsiveness
Strong communication often reflects operational reliability. Professional suppliers respond quickly, provide detailed quotations, and explain technical specifications clearly. Buyers should evaluate whether suppliers understand export requirements, packaging standards, and international compliance expectations during early discussions.
Experienced manufacturers also provide production schedules, product drawings, and sample approvals before manufacturing begins. This level of organization reduces misunderstandings and helps buyers manage project timelines more effectively. Good communication becomes especially important for customized wooden door wholesale orders.
How Do You Evaluate Wooden Door Quality Before Importing?
Quality evaluation protects importers from costly product defects and customer complaints. Buyers should inspect materials, construction methods, finishes, and moisture resistance before approving production. Thorough product testing improves long-term business performance and customer satisfaction.
Inspect Raw Materials Carefully
Wood species directly influence durability, appearance, and product value. Hardwood materials such as oak and walnut offer strong structural performance and premium visual appeal. Softer materials such as pine provide lower-cost alternatives for interior applications and budget-sensitive construction projects.
Buyers should also confirm whether the wood has undergone proper kiln drying. Moisture content plays a critical role in preventing warping, swelling, and cracking after installation. Industry standards often recommend moisture levels between 8% and 12% for exported wooden doors, depending on destination climate conditions.
Examine Surface Finishing
Surface finishing affects appearance, durability, and maintenance requirements. Buyers should inspect paint consistency, edge smoothness, coating adhesion, and veneer quality during sample evaluation. High-quality finishes improve scratch resistance and protect wooden surfaces from environmental exposure during long-term use.
Chinese manufacturers now use automated UV coating systems and environmentally friendly water-based paints to improve product quality. These advanced finishing technologies help manufacturers meet stricter environmental regulations in Europe, North America, and Middle Eastern markets.
Request Product Samples
Product samples allow buyers to evaluate construction quality before bulk production begins. Samples help businesses confirm dimensions, color consistency, material quality, and hardware compatibility. This process reduces misunderstandings and prevents large-scale production errors during customized manufacturing projects.
Importers should test samples under practical installation conditions whenever possible. Door opening performance, lock fitting, hinge alignment, and structural strength provide valuable information about manufacturing standards. Detailed sample approval creates a reliable reference point for future production inspections.
What Specifications Should Buyers Confirm Before Ordering?
Clear product specifications reduce production mistakes and improve supplier communication. Buyers should document all technical details carefully before finalizing contracts. Detailed specifications also help inspection teams verify compliance during manufacturing and pre-shipment reviews.
Confirm Door Dimensions and Construction
Importers should confirm door thickness, frame dimensions, opening direction, and installation requirements before production begins. Different countries follow different sizing standards, so buyers must provide accurate technical drawings and measurements to suppliers.
Manufacturers often support custom sizes for hotels, villas, apartments, and commercial projects. However, customized products may increase production time and minimum order requirements. Buyers should discuss these factors during quotation negotiations to avoid unexpected delays.
Specify Surface Finishes and Colors
Surface finish selection affects product appearance, durability, and market positioning. Common finishes include veneer, laminate, PU paint, and UV coating systems. Buyers should confirm texture, gloss level, and color consistency requirements before approving production.
Professional suppliers often provide finished catalogs and color-matching services for customized projects. Importers should request physical finish samples because digital images may not accurately represent the final product appearance. Clear finish approval reduces customer dissatisfaction after delivery.
Choose Hardware and Accessories
Many Chinese manufacturers offer integrated hardware packages that include hinges, handles, locks, and smart access systems. Integrated sourcing simplifies procurement and improves installation compatibility for project contractors and distributors.
Importers should verify hardware material quality, corrosion resistance, and certification compliance before shipment. High-quality hardware improves overall product value and reduces future maintenance problems. Reliable suppliers typically recommend hardware options based on target market requirements and usage conditions.
How Do Pricing and MOQ Work for Wooden Door Imports?
Pricing structures vary according to material selection, customization level, production complexity, and order volume. Buyers should understand all cost components before finalizing purchasing agreements. Transparent pricing analysis improves budgeting accuracy and long-term sourcing efficiency.
What Factors Affect Wooden Door Pricing?
Raw material selection significantly influences manufacturing costs. Solid hardwood doors usually cost more than MDF or engineered wood products because they require premium timber and longer processing times. Decorative carvings, premium finishes, and fire-rated features also increase production expenses.
Order quantity also impacts unit pricing. Larger orders allow factories to optimize material purchasing and production scheduling, which reduces manufacturing costs. Buyers importing Bulk wooden door shipments often receive better pricing through container-based procurement strategies.
Understand Minimum Order Quantities
Most Chinese factories establish MOQ requirements to maintain efficient production planning. Standard wooden door models may support lower order quantities, while customized products usually require larger production volumes. Buyers should negotiate flexible MOQ arrangements whenever possible.
Some manufacturers allow mixed-model container orders that combine multiple designs within one shipment. This approach helps distributors test market demand while maintaining cost efficiency. Flexible order structures also support seasonal inventory management for growing businesses.
Identify Hidden Import Costs
Importers must calculate shipping fees, customs duties, inspection charges, warehousing costs, and inland transportation expenses when estimating total procurement costs. Ignoring these expenses can reduce profitability and disrupt project budgets.
Sea freight remains the most cost-effective shipping option for large wooden door orders. However, fluctuating container rates and port congestion can affect final transportation costs. Businesses should work with experienced freight forwarders to improve logistics planning and cost control.
How Does the Wooden Door Manufacturing Process Work?
Understanding the manufacturing process helps buyers evaluate supplier capabilities and quality standards. Modern Chinese factories combine automation with skilled craftsmanship to produce consistent products for international export markets.
Material Preparation and Drying
Manufacturers begin production by selecting and drying raw wood materials. Kiln drying removes excess moisture and stabilizes the wood structure before processing begins. Proper drying reduces the risk of cracking, warping, and deformation during transportation and installation.
Factories often store wood materials in climate-controlled environments to maintain stable moisture levels. This process improves manufacturing consistency and product durability. Buyers should confirm drying procedures during factory evaluations because moisture control directly affects long-term product performance.
CNC Cutting and Assembly
Modern factories use CNC machinery to improve precision during cutting and shaping operations. Automated systems produce accurate dimensions and reduce manufacturing errors during large production runs. Precision machining also improves hardware fitting and installation compatibility.
Workers then assemble door panels, frames, and internal structures according to approved technical drawings. Experienced factories implement multiple inspection stages during assembly to identify defects before finishing operations begin. This process improves overall product consistency and reduces rejection rates.
Surface Treatment and Final Inspection
Manufacturers apply sanding, painting, veneering, and protective coatings during finishing operations. Automated spray lines improve coating consistency and reduce surface imperfections. Final inspection teams then evaluate dimensions, appearance, hardware fitting, and packaging quality before shipment approval.
Many export-focused factories maintain dedicated quality control departments that follow international inspection standards. Consistent inspection procedures help suppliers meet buyer expectations and reduce product claims after delivery.
What Shipping Methods Are Best for Importing Wooden Doors?
Shipping strategy directly affects transportation costs, delivery timelines, and product safety. Buyers should select shipping methods according to order volume, project schedule, and destination market requirements.
Sea Freight for Large Orders
Sea freight provides the most economical transportation solution for large wooden door shipments. Full Container Load shipping reduces handling risks and improves cargo protection during international transit. Many importers prefer FCL shipping because it supports efficient container utilization and predictable logistics management.
Less than Container Load shipping offers flexibility for smaller orders but may increase handling risks during consolidation. Buyers importing smaller quantities should evaluate whether shared container shipping provides sufficient protection for delicate wooden products.
Packaging for Export Protection
Export packaging protects wooden doors from moisture, scratches, and impact damage during long-distance transportation. Reliable manufacturers use foam protection, reinforced corner guards, wooden crates, and waterproof wrapping materials to improve cargo safety.
Importers should confirm packaging standards before production begins because inadequate packaging often causes costly product damage. Strong packaging reduces insurance claims and improves customer satisfaction after delivery.
Understand Incoterms Clearly
Incoterms define responsibilities between buyers and suppliers during international shipping transactions. Common trade terms include FOB, CIF, EXW, and DDP. Buyers should understand these terms clearly to avoid misunderstandings regarding shipping costs and customs responsibilities.
FOB agreements remain popular for wooden door wholesale transactions because they provide buyers with greater control over freight arrangements. However, less experienced importers may prefer CIF or DDP arrangements for simplified logistics management.
What Documents Are Required for Wooden Door Imports?
Proper documentation ensures smooth customs clearance and regulatory compliance during international shipping. Missing or inaccurate paperwork can delay shipments and increase import costs significantly.
Essential Shipping Documents
Importers typically require commercial invoices, packing lists, bills of lading, and certificates of origin for customs clearance. Some countries also require fumigation certificates and wood treatment documentation for wooden product imports.
Accurate documentation helps customs authorities verify product classification and regulatory compliance. Buyers should review all paperwork carefully before shipment departure to prevent customs delays and additional inspection costs.
Fumigation and Compliance Requirements
Many countries enforce strict regulations for imported wooden products to prevent pest contamination and environmental risks. Suppliers may need to provide ISPM 15 compliance documentation and fumigation certificates depending on packaging materials and destination regulations.
Importers should consult customs brokers and local authorities before placing orders to confirm regulatory requirements. Early compliance planning reduces shipment delays and protects businesses from customs penalties.
How Can Buyers Manage Quality Control Effectively?
Quality control remains essential when importing from overseas suppliers. Structured inspection procedures help buyers maintain product consistency and reduce operational risks.
Conduct Multi-Stage Inspections
Professional importers often perform pre-production, during-production, and pre-shipment inspections to monitor manufacturing quality. Multi-stage inspections identify defects early and reduce the risk of receiving non-compliant products.
Third-party inspection companies provide independent assessments of dimensions, finishing quality, hardware installation, and packaging conditions. These inspections help buyers verify whether suppliers meet contractual specifications before shipment release.
Build Long-Term Supplier Relationships
Strong supplier relationships improve communication, production consistency, and pricing stability over time. Long-term partnerships encourage suppliers to prioritize quality and maintain reliable delivery schedules for repeat buyers.
Regular communication also supports better production planning and faster issue resolution. Buyers who establish stable sourcing relationships often receive better pricing, flexible MOQs, and priority manufacturing support during high-demand seasons.
What Trends Are Shaping the Wooden Door Industry?
The wooden door industry continues to evolve as sustainability, smart technology, and modern design preferences influence global demand. Importers who understand market trends can position their businesses more effectively in competitive markets.
Eco-Friendly Wooden Doors
Sustainability has become a major purchasing factor for construction companies and property developers. Buyers increasingly request FSC-certified wood materials, low-VOC coatings, and environmentally responsible manufacturing processes for commercial projects.
According to the Forest Stewardship Council, certified forest products continue to gain global demand due to growing environmental awareness and green building standards. Chinese manufacturers now invest heavily in sustainable production systems to meet these international market expectations.
Smart and Customized Door Solutions
Modern construction projects increasingly integrate smart access systems, digital locks, and customized architectural designs. Buyers now request integrated hardware solutions that improve security and convenience for residential and commercial applications.
Customization also continues to drive growth in the premium wooden door market. Developers, hotels, and luxury residential projects often require unique finishes, oversized dimensions, and branded design elements. Flexible manufacturers can capitalize on these growing market opportunities.
